震惊!dat文件怎么修改内容?这些方法你一定要知道! (如何修改dat文件数据)
震惊!dat文件怎么修改内容?这些方法你一定要知道!
在数字化的时代,我们会接触到各种各样的文件格式,dat文件就是其中之一。然而,很多人在面对dat文件时,往往会被一个问题所困扰:dat文件怎么修改内容?本文将围绕这一核心问题,详细探讨dat文件的相关知识以及修改其内容的方法。
一、dat文件是什么?
在深入探讨如何修改dat文件内容之前,我们首先要了解dat文件到底是什么。dat并不是一种特定的文件格式,它更像是一种通用的数据文件扩展名。在不同的软件和系统中,dat文件可能代表着完全不同的含义。
例如,在一些数据库管理系统中,dat文件可能用于存储数据库中的数据;在多媒体软件里,dat文件可能是视频或音频数据文件;在某些游戏中,dat文件可能包含着游戏的关卡、角色等重要数据。正是由于dat文件的多样性,使得修改其内容变得相对复杂。
常见问题:dat文件可以直接打开吗?
这是很多人在遇到dat文件时首先会想到的问题。答案是不一定。由于dat文件没有固定的格式,它能否直接打开取决于创建该文件的应用程序。有些dat文件可以使用文本编辑器(如记事本)打开,因为它们是以纯文本形式存储的;而有些dat文件则需要特定的软件才能打开,比如某些游戏的dat文件,需要使用专门的游戏修改工具。
二、修改dat文件内容前的准备工作
备份文件
在尝试修改dat文件内容之前,一定要备份原始文件。因为在修改过程中可能会出现各种意外情况,如误操作、软件故障等,导致文件损坏。备份文件可以让你在出现问题时恢复到原始状态,避免数据丢失。
确定文件类型
如前文所述,dat文件的类型多种多样。在修改之前,你需要确定该文件的具体类型。可以通过以下几种方法来判断: 1. 查看文件关联程序:在操作系统中,右键点击dat文件,选择“属性”,查看“打开方式”一栏,这可以帮助你了解该文件通常使用什么程序打开。 2. 查看文件来源:回忆该文件是从哪里获得的,是某个软件生成的,还是从网上下载的。了解文件来源可以为判断文件类型提供线索。 3.使用文件分析工具:有一些专门的文件分析工具可以帮助你确定文件的类型,如FileInfo等。
常见问题:如果不确定文件类型,还能修改吗?
如果不确定文件类型,直接修改可能会导致文件损坏。建议先进行一些简单的测试,如使用文本编辑器打开文件,查看是否为可读的文本内容。如果是乱码,说明该文件可能不是纯文本格式,需要进一步寻找合适的工具。
三、修改dat文件内容的方法
方法一:使用文本编辑器
如果dat文件是以纯文本形式存储的,那么可以使用文本编辑器(如记事本、Notepad++等)来修改其内容。具体步骤如下: 1. 右键点击dat文件,选择“打开方式”,然后选择你喜欢的文本编辑器。 2. 在文本编辑器中打开文件后,你可以直接对文件内容进行修改。 3. 修改完成后,点击“保存”即可。
常见问题:使用文本编辑器打开dat文件出现乱码怎么办?
如果出现乱码,可能是因为文件不是纯文本格式,或者文件使用了特定的编码方式。可以尝试更改文本编辑器的编码方式,如将编码设置为UTF - 8、GBK等。如果仍然无法解决,说明该文件可能需要使用其他工具来打开和修改。
方法二:使用专门的软件
对于一些特定类型的dat文件,需要使用专门的软件来修改。例如: 1. 数据库相关的dat文件:如果dat文件是数据库的数据文件,那么需要使用相应的数据库管理系统(如MySQL、SQLite等)来修改。具体步骤包括连接到数据库、执行SQL语句来修改数据等。 2.游戏相关的dat文件:很多游戏的dat文件包含着游戏的重要数据,如关卡信息、角色属性等。对于这类文件,需要使用专门的游戏修改工具。这些工具可以帮助你解析和修改游戏dat文件中的数据。
常见问题:专门的软件在哪里可以找到?
可以通过以下几种途径找到专门的软件: 1. 官方网站:访问相关软件或游戏的官方网站,查看是否提供了专门的文件修改工具。 2. 软件下载平台:如华军软件园、太平洋下载中心等,在这些平台上搜索相关的工具。 3.论坛和社区:一些技术论坛和游戏社区中,会有用户分享相关的修改工具和经验。
方法三:编程修改
如果你具备一定的编程能力,也可以通过编写程序来修改dat文件内容。不同的编程语言有不同的文件操作方法,以下是一个使用Python语言修改dat文件的简单示例:
```python
打开dat文件
with open('example.dat', 'r+b') as file: # 读取文件内容 content = file.read() # 修改内容(这里只是简单示例,实际根据需求修改) new_content = content.replace(b'old_text', b'new_text') # 将文件指针移动到文件开头 file.seek(0) # 写入修改后的内容 file.write(new_content) # 截断文件,确保文件大小正确 file.truncate() ```
常见问题:编程修改dat文件难吗?
编程修改dat文件需要一定的编程基础。如果你熟悉文件操作和编程语言,那么相对来说并不难。但如果你没有编程经验,可能需要花费一些时间来学习相关的知识。
四、分享与注意事项
分享经验
在修改dat文件的过程中,很多人都积累了丰富的经验。以下是一些网友分享的实用经验: 1. 多尝试不同的工具:如果一种方法或工具无法满足需求,可以尝试其他的方法和工具。有时候,换一种工具可能就能轻松解决问题。 2. 参考他人的经验:在网络上搜索相关的问题和解决方案,很多人会分享自己修改dat文件的经验和技巧。参考这些经验可以让你少走很多弯路。
注意事项
合法性问题:在修改dat文件时,要确保你的行为是合法的。例如,修改游戏的dat文件可能违反游戏的使用条款,甚至可能涉及到侵权问题。数据安全:在修改文件内容时,要注意数据的安全性。避免在不安全的网络环境下进行修改操作,防止数据泄露。总之,修改dat文件内容并不是一件难事,只要你了解文件的类型,选择合适的方法和工具,并注意相关的问题,就可以顺利地完成修改。希望本文介绍的方法和知识能够对你有所帮助。

